Table 3.
Minute signals used as the source signals for feature extraction in the CDI model.
Signal name | Signal description |
---|---|
Heart rate | 10% Trim mean average of beat to beat heart rate values |
Time domain heart rate variability | 10% Trim mean average of time domain heart rate variability |
Respiration rate | 10% Trim mean average of respiration rate |
Count of magnitude | Average of activity count using the 3-axis accelerometer vector magnitude |
Gross activity | Average of root mean squared of 3-axis accelerometer signal |
Magnitude of uni counts | Average of vector magnitude of 3-axis univariate accelerometer activity counts |
A-Fib percent | Percent of time classified as exhibiting atrial fibrillation or atrial flutter |
Sleep | Percent of time classified as sleeping |
Step count | Number of steps |
Tilt | 10% Trim mean of tilt angle of the torso (where 90 degrees is upright) |
Trailing activity | Average of gross activity after application of a 3 minute moving average filter |
Walk percent | Percent of time classified as ambulation (inclusive of walking and running) |
Skin temperature | Median skin temperature, in degrees celcius |
Activity residual | 10% Trim mean average of trailing activity residual |
Heart rate residual | 10% Trim mean average of heart rate residual |
Respiration rate residual | 10% Trim mean average of respiration rate residual |
MCI | 10% TrIm Mean Average of MCI (multivariate change index)[?] |
The minute source signals are generated by the pinpointIQ™ platform.
